Abstract

Systems and methods for improving the handing of communications between network applications in a computer system with connectivity services interfaces that seamlessly handle the communications in an easy-to-use, secure, message-oriented environment are disclosed. Embodiments of systems and methods for maintaining ownership of sessions by applications, and for avoiding the orphaning of communication sessions when activities are terminated are also disclosed. Also disclosed are embodiments of systems and methods for accessing data using authentication credentials different than the authentication credentials associated with a user that is requesting access to the data. Embodiments of systems and methods for authenticating credentials for establishing a secure communication connection between applications executing on different platforms are also disclosed.

Claims (45)

1. A method for maintaining ownership of sessions by applications, comprising:

obtaining, by a processor, a communication session table, wherein the communication session table comprises a data structure with information used to establish and maintain a communication session between network applications;

determining, by the processor, if an activity table exists, wherein an activity table comprises a list of operations scheduled for execution;

creating an activity table when an activity table is determined to not exist;

determining, by the processor, when an activity table is determined to exist, if the session table is linked to the activity table or to another activity table;

linking, by the processor, the session table to the activity table when the activity table is determined to exist, the session table is determined to not already be linked to the activity table, and the session table is referenced by the activity table; and

performing, by the processor, a computer instruction requested by a user on the communication session identified in the session table when the activity table exists and the session table is linked to the activity table,

wherein, when the session table is determined to be linked to the another activity table, the method further comprises:

stopping an un-owned session timer associated with the session table;

removing the link between the session table and the another activity table and

linking the session table to the activity table.

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ein obtaining comprises receiving a request to establish a communication session, and wherein the request includes the session table.

3. The method of claim 1 , wherein obtaining comprises creating the session table.

4. The method of claim 1 , further comprising starting an un-owned session timer when the session table is determined to not be linked to an activity table, wherein when the timer expires the session is aborted if the session is valid, and no action is taken if the session is not valid.
